Key Differences

SharkBite (A) is a well-reviewed stainless steel clamp ring with a focus on durability and leak resistance and requires a PEX clamp tool; it comes in a 100-count pack. PXZBLG (B) offers a larger 200-pack and single-ear design for sealing and represents better unit-value pricing but has far fewer customer reviews and limited size detail
